A straight up bebop jazz banger from Magic Number. This second single is a massive departure from their house sound, in which they deliver a timeless piece of vocal jazz. Once again featuring the beautiful vocal talents of Angela Armstrong, the piano skills of Zara Mcfarlane’s Peter Edwards and the incredible trumpet talent that is Dominic Glover. This is a feel good song for the summer. Taken from their album entitled “Something’s Old, Something’s New”. Magic Number are Ross Hillard and Tom Wardle.
